Stabilization of oscillating modes in the LiNdP/sub 4/O/sub 12/ laser

Suppression of mode competition in a LiNdP/sub 4/O/sub 12/ (LNP) laser is reported. The stabilization of the oscillating modes was achieved with a quartz quarter-wave plate placed within an optical resonator without any external modulation.
